summer

/ˈsʌmər/

Summer is the warmest season of the year, occurring between spring and autumn when the sun is at its highest point in the sky. It is typically characterized by long days, short nights, and hot weather, making it a popular time for holidays and outdoor recreation.

सामान्य वाक्यांश

Indian summer

a period of unseasonably warm, dry weather in autumn

One swallow doesn't make a summer

one good event does not mean that everything is going to be good

Summer break

the period during the summer when schools are closed

अक्सर इससे भ्रम होता है

summer vs Spring

Spring is the season of growth before summer, while summer is the peak heat.

summer vs Sum

Sum is a mathematical total, whereas summer is a season.

इस्तेमाल की जानकारी

The word 'summer' is usually used with the preposition 'in' (e.g., 'in the summer'). It can also be used as an adjective to describe things related to the season, such as 'summer dress' or 'summer solstice'.

⚠️

सामान्य गलतियाँ

Learners often capitalize 'summer' like a proper noun, but seasons are not capitalized in English unless they are part of a title or start a sentence.

📖

शब्द की उत्पत्ति

From the Old English 'sumor', which comes from a Proto-Indo-European root meaning 'half-year'.

व्याकरण पैटर्न

Countable noun: 'I have spent many summers in Italy.' Used with the definite article: 'I like the summer.' Attributive use: 'She bought a new summer hat.'
🌍

सांस्कृतिक संदर्भ

In many English-speaking cultures, summer is strongly associated with the longest school holiday of the year and family road trips.
